In this episode, we’re going to drop in on The Good Joy Podcast where I was recently a guest. And I’ve excerpted a portion of the conversation to share with you here. I hope you’ll enjoy being a fly on the wall as Pamela Sylvan and I discuss various topics, including collaboration, confidence and the importance of listening to other people’s stories.
Here are my Top 10 Takeaways from this episode:
1. When we connect with others who aren’t like us, we become aware of our own blind spots.
2. When we’re collaborating, we’re not competing.
3. There’s enough to go around; if you succeed, it doesn’t mean I fail.
4. We can bring our own chair to the table that other people have built -- OR we can build an entirely new table and start our own conversation.
5. Mindset is one of the most important aspects of any business.
6. Our everyday language reveals our confidence level.
7. Collaboration requires that we contribute to the conversation as much as we take in other people’s ideas.
8. We need examples of strong women around us; after all, if we can see it, we can be it.
9. Diversity brings a new perspective to the way we view ourselves, the world and other people in it.
10. Paying attention to other people’s stories help us become more empathetic towards other human being sin this world.
